Understanding Responsive Web Design: Beyond Basic Mobile Compatibility
Responsive web design represents a fundamental shift in how websites are conceived, designed, and developed. Rather than creating separate mobile and desktop versions, responsive design uses flexible grid systems, scalable images, and CSS media queries to ensure optimal viewing experiences across all devices and screen sizes.
The core principles of effective responsive web design include:
- Fluid Grid Systems: Layouts that adapt proportionally to screen dimensions rather than fixed pixel measurements
- Flexible Media: Images and videos that scale appropriately without breaking layout integrity
- CSS Media Queries: Code that applies different styling rules based on device characteristics
- Progressive Enhancement: Building core functionality first, then adding advanced features for capable devices
- Touch-Friendly Navigation: Interface elements optimized for finger navigation on mobile devices

Performance Optimization for Multi-Device Success
London’s fast-paced business environment demands websites that load quickly across all devices. Responsive web design London implementations must prioritize performance optimization to meet user expectations and search engine requirements. Key performance considerations include:
- Image Optimization: Implementing responsive images that serve appropriate file sizes based on device capabilities
- Code Efficiency: Minimizing CSS and JavaScript to reduce load times across slower mobile connections
- Caching Strategies: Leveraging browser and server caching to improve repeat visit performance
- Content Delivery Networks: Using CDNs to ensure fast content delivery across London and globally
- Progressive Loading: Prioritizing critical content while loading secondary elements asynchronously

Navigation and User Experience Across Devices
Effective responsive web design requires rethinking navigation patterns for different screen sizes and interaction methods. London businesses need navigation systems that work intuitively whether users are browsing on desktop computers in office environments or smartphones during commutes.
Critical navigation considerations include:
- Hamburger Menus: Implementing collapsible navigation that doesn’t sacrifice discoverability
- Touch Targets: Ensuring buttons and links are appropriately sized for finger navigation
- Breadcrumbs: Providing clear navigation paths that work effectively on smaller screens
- Search Functionality: Making search prominent and functional across all device types
- Call-to-Action Placement: Positioning conversion elements where they’re most effective on each device type

Framework Selection and Development Approaches
Successful responsive web design London implementations require careful consideration of technical frameworks and development methodologies. The choice between custom development, framework-based approaches, or hybrid solutions significantly impacts project outcomes, maintenance requirements, and long-term scalability.
Popular frameworks for responsive development include:
- Bootstrap: Comprehensive framework offering rapid development capabilities
- Foundation: Flexible framework with advanced responsive features
- Tailwind CSS: Utility-first approach enabling custom responsive designs
- Custom CSS Grid and Flexbox: Native CSS solutions for maximum control
- Component-Based Systems: React, Vue, or Angular implementations for complex applications
